We’re looking for an experienced Financial Reporting and Consolidations Manager responsible for supporting the Company’s external financial reporting function.

This role will direct the planning and implementation of new processes and will ensure business results are achieved by translating company strategies into functional priorities and executable action plans.

  • External Reporting Responsibilities
  • Prepares the corporation’s external financial statements, including quarterly 10-Q and annual Form 10-K filings, including MD&A, financial statements and footnotes.
  • Analyzes new accounting standards and reporting guidance issued by FASB, SEC, EITF and other standard setting bodies to determine implication on financial operations and reporting.
  • Initiates and develops the Company’s efforts to submit SEC Filings in XBRL.
  • Supports the Company’s quarterly earnings release and other press releases.
  • Reviews the preparation of the Company’s annual proxy statement.
  • Works as part of a team to prepare the Company’s Annual Report.
  • Internal Reporting Responsibilities
  • Develops technical accounting policies and procedures and ensures compliance among the operating segments.
  • Manages the financial statement (income statement, balance sheet, cash flow) consolidation process.
  • Manages the preparation of internal monthly executive management financial reports.
  • Assists in the preparation of presentations for investors and Board of Directors.
  • Works with external auditors during the audit process and as issues arise.
  • Tracks, analyzes and reports on the Company’s competition’s financial results.
  • Supports due diligence and accounting / finance integration efforts with acquisitions.
  • Assists in special projects / ad hoc analysis as required.
  • Other Accounting Duties
  • Supports the Company’s acquisition initiative through performance of due diligence, participation on acquisition teams and development and implementation of accounting processes for acquired companies.

Qualifications & Requirements :

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ting required, MBA or Master’s in Accounting preferred, with at least 7 years of relevant experience including a combination of public accounting experience and corporate financial accounting and reporting experience in a medium to large size corporation, or an equivalent combination of education and experience. CPA required.
  • Strong knowledge of GAAP and prior experience with drafting SEC reporting documents required
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to work with multiple groups and negotiate competing priorities
  • Well-developed project management skills to facilitate the quarterly close process
  • Exceptional service orientation
  • Superior analytical, evaluative, and problem-solving abilities
  • Self-motivated and able to work effectively and efficiently under pressure
  • Experience with Workiva and SAP / BPC preferred
